Steve Ghiglieri was named plant manager for the Anheuser-Busch Houston brewery in January 2001. Steve served as brewmaster for the Houston brewery for two years prior to his new position.
Earlier in his career, Steve held various brewing production positions with increasing responsibility at Anheuser-Busch facilities in St. Louis, Los Angeles and Williamsburg, Va. While in St. Louis, Steve was responsible for the international brewing operations for several years and also held a position in corporate operations.
Steve graduated from the University of California-Davis with a master’s degree in food science.
Dave Maxwell was named resident brewmaster for the Houston brewery in January 2001. Maxwell was promoted to the position after serving as senior assistant brewmaster at the Houston plant. He began his career with Anheuser-Busch in the Research Pilot brewery in 1989 and has held positions in brewing at the Anheuser-Busch breweries in Fairfield, Calif., St. Louis and Houston.
Dave is a graduate of Southern Illinois University-Carbondale with a microbiology degree. He enjoys golf, biking and family outings with his wife and three children.
